For those drawn to authentic culture and untouched nature, the "Langtang Valley Trek" offers a rare trekking experience through Nepal’s remote Tamang Heritage trail. Perfect for both young adults and seniors who crave adventure and cultural discovery, this route winds through traditional Tamang villages, vibrant rhododendron forests, and delivers panoramic mountain views. The Tamang people, with their deep Tibetan roots, maintain a lifestyle largely unaffected by tourism, offering trekkers genuine cultural encounters. In spring, the forests burst into bloom, attracting a diversity of birds and butterflies, while the vantage point at Goljung Pass unveils breathtaking vistas of Langtang and distant Kerung in Tibet. Wildlife enthusiasts might spot elusive creatures like red pandas, bears, or even leopards. Recently opened to trekkers, this off-the-beaten-path journey combines dramatic landscapes, snow-capped peaks, and ancient settlements, making it an unmissable trip for those seeking Nepal’s lesser-known wonders.
